如何在谷歌浏览器中使用开发者工具
在现代网页开发和调试过程中,谷歌浏览器的开发者工具(Chrome DevTools)无疑是一个强大的工具。无论你是新手还是有经验的开发者,掌握这些工具都能提升你的工作效率,帮助你更加深入地理解网页的运行机制。本文将介绍如何在谷歌浏览器中使用开发者工具,涵盖基本功能及其应用场景。
打开开发者工具
第一步,打开谷歌浏览器,然后访问任何你想要分析的网页。接下来,你可以通过以下几种方式打开开发者工具:
1. 使用快捷键:Windows系统中按下F12或Ctrl+Shift+I,Mac系统中按下Cmd+Option+I。
2. 右键菜单:在网页上任意位置右键点击,选择“检查”或“检查元素”。
3. 菜单导航:点击浏览器右上角的三点图标,依次选择“更多工具” > “开发者工具”。
主要功能介绍
一旦打开开发者工具,你将看到一个包含多个标签页的界面。常用的标签页包括:
1. **Elements(元素)**:这个标签允许你查看和修改网页的HTML和CSS结构。你可以通过鼠标悬停和点击的方式快速选择和编辑页面元素的样式,实时查看修改效果,非常适合调试布局和样式问题。
2. **Console(控制台)**:控制台用于查看输出信息和执行JavaScript代码。你可以使用它来调试代码,查看错误消息或者执行试验性的脚本。通过直接在控制台输入命令,可以与页面进行交互。
3. **Network(网络)**:此标签展示了网页加载的所有网络请求,包括HTML、CSS、JavaScript文件、图片等。你可以查看每个请求的状态、加载时间和响应数据,帮助你优化页面性能和找出加载瓶颈。
4. **Sources(源代码)**:在这个标签中,你可以查看所有的JavaScript文件,并进行调试。你可以在这里设置断点,单步执行代码,非常适合分析复杂的脚本和调试逻辑错误。
5. **Performance(性能)**:通过使用这个标签,你能够录制网页的运行表现,从而进行性能分析。它帮助你识别性能瓶颈,优化用户体验。
6. **Application(应用)**:这个标签可以查看和管理网页存储的数据,包括Cookies、Local Storage、Session Storage等。对于需要保存用户状态的应用程序来说,这些工具至关重要。
7. **Security(安全)**:在此标签下,你可以查看网页的SSL证书信息,并检查网站的安全性问题。
使用技巧
1. **页面响应式设计测试**:在开发者工具中,点击左上角的手机图标可进入设备模式,这样你可以模拟不同设备的显示效果,方便你进行响应式设计测试。
2. **快速CSS修改**:在Elements选项卡中,双击CSS属性值可以快速编辑,实时观察效果,这样有助于快速调整样式而无需频繁返回代码编辑器。
3. **利用Console调试**:可以使用`console.log()`来输出调试信息,还可以使用`console.table()`来更优雅地展示数组和对象数据,便于分析。
4. **性能分析**:定期使用Performance标签录制页面行为,以识别需要优化的部分,提升网站表现。
总结
谷歌浏览器的开发者工具是网页开发者必不可少的利器。通过学习和熟悉其各个功能,你可以更快速地调试网页、优化性能、提升用户体验。无论你是进行前端开发,还是分析和优化现有网站,开发者工具都能为你提供巨大的帮助。希望本文能激发你深入探索和利用这些工具,提高你的开发效率。